deject

/dɪˈdʒɛkt/
verb
  1. To make someone feel sad, discouraged, or disappointed.
    • Failing the test dejected her more than she expected.
    • The bad news dejected the entire team before the big game.
    • Don't let one rude comment deject you from pursuing your dream.
